If you love beer and you want to see some of your favorite master brewers getting down to their favorite karaoke tunes, you won’t want to miss the next Drink Brew City Tap Takeover and Karaoke Night this Wednesday, June 14 at Third Space Brewery

The event, which takes place from 6 to 9 p.m., will feature beer from 12 local breweries including City Lights, D14, Eagle Park, Explorium Brewpub, The Fermentorium, Good City Brewing, Lakefront Brewery, Milwaukee Brewing Co., Third Space Brewing, MobCraft Beer, Raised Grain and Sprecher Brewing Co.

Representatives and owners from each brewery also will be on premise, both to chat with attendees about their breweries and to wow the crowd with their karaoke talents. And there’s no chickening out allowed. In fact, all participating breweries have agreed to sing at least one song during the course of the evening.

Attendees, too, are encouraged to get in on the action. Sign up to sing a song and take on the brewmasters in a fun, friendly karaoke competition. Weather permitting, karaoke will be hosted in Third Space’s outdoor beer garden.

Can’t make it to the event, but would love to grab a beer earlier? All featured beers for the Drink Brew City Tap Takeover will be available at Third Space Brewing beginning at 4 p.m. on the day of the event.
